There are no lights that you can just replace your current ones in the bathroom. From what I've read, the light source must be really close to the orchid for it to work. I strongly suggest moving your Onc. near the east window of your dining room and placing it on a humidity tray with gravel and water (should not touch bottom of pot). In addition, mist your Onc. in the morning. This will help a little with increasing humidity.
